System Verdict
This is a solid hydrating, mildly brightening serum with decent blemish-support, but its essential oil fragrance and scattered vitamin C derivatives keep it from being a top-tier treatment. Efficacy is driven mainly by mid-list niacinamide, multiple humectants, soothing agents like panthenol and allantoin, and some supporting brightening/antioxidant botanicals, while the three vitamin C forms appear low enough in the list that their concentration is likely modest and not at clinically strong levels; overall you get helpful hydration and tone support rather than a powerhouse anti-acne or pigment-correcting treatment.

Does numbuzin No.5 Goodbye Blemish Serum contain fragrance or known irritants?

DemythSkin flags these ingredients in numbuzin No.5 Goodbye Blemish Serum as potential irritants: Citrus Limon (Lemon) Peel Oil, Citrus Aurantium Dulcis (Orange) Peel Oil, Citrus Aurantifolia (Lime) Oil, Limonene, Citral.

How is numbuzin No.5 Goodbye Blemish Serum scored?

DemythSkin grades every product on two independent axes: efficacy (whether the ingredients have clinical evidence of working) and safety (irritation and sensitisation risk). Ingredients are classified S through D against a database of over 3,000 compounds. No brand pays for a score.
